Check out this post where Suja breaks it down & explains the ...Blending, on the other hand, involves processing whole fruits and vegetables in a blender, preserving both the juice and the fiber. This method provides a more balanced nutritional profile, as the fiber helps slow down digestion, promotes fullness, and supports gut health. Process until finely chopped or mashed.Roughly chop the cucumber. Chop the apple, keeping the skin on. Place the cucumber, apple, water, and salt in a blender. Blend on high until pureed and a juice forms. Pass the juice through a fine mesh sieve or a nut milk bag to strain out the pulp. Discard the pulp (or use: see ideas above).However, the concentration of ascorbic acid in apple, pear, and mandarin orange juices was significantly (P<0.05) higher in juice that had been processed by juicing, rather than blending. The juices with the highest ascorbic acid (233.9 mg/serving), total polyphenols (862.3 mg gallic acid equivalents/serving), and flavonoids (295.1 mg quercetin ...

Or add a bit of water and soap to the blender and push the clean ...Aug 23, 2023 · In general, think about making juice with a blender instead of with a juicing machine. Blending the parts of fruits and vegetables that can be eaten produces a drink with more healthy plant chemicals and fiber. If you try juicing, make only as much juice as you can drink at once. Harmful bacteria can grow quickly in freshly made juice. Red/Orange Vegetable Juice. Pour the blended juice through a nut milk bag or a fine cheesecloth.Jul 17, 2023 · Blending (i.e. making a smoothie) is the process of grinding up the fruit and vegetables in a blender (including all the skin / flesh / etc.) to make a smoothie. A smoothie also almost always contains extra liquid, since liquid is required to assist the blending process. This liquid is usually non-dairy milk, coconut water, or other liquid.

Add the most delicate ingredients first, such as leafy greens and herbs. 4. Follow with soft vegetables and/or fruits (tomatoes, berries, etc.). 5. Finish with hard vegetables and/or fruits (apples, celery, etc.). Our recipe ingredients are listed in this order. 6. Drink fresh juice within a day or freeze it.
